イーサリアム(ETH)アップグレードの最新情報と影響
イーサリアムは、ビットコインに次ぐ時価総額を誇る主要な暗号資産であり、分散型アプリケーション(DApps)やスマートコントラクトの基盤として広く利用されています。その進化は常に進行しており、ネットワークの拡張性、セキュリティ、持続可能性を向上させるためのアップグレードが継続的に行われています。本稿では、イーサリアムの主要なアップグレードの最新情報と、それがもたらす影響について詳細に解説します。
1. イーサリアムの現状と課題
イーサリアムは、当初からPoW(Proof of Work)というコンセンサスアルゴリズムを採用していました。しかし、PoWは計算資源を大量に消費し、スケーラビリティの問題を引き起こすことが知られています。具体的には、トランザクション処理速度が遅く、ガス代(トランザクション手数料)が高騰するという課題がありました。これらの課題は、イーサリアムの普及を阻害する要因となっていました。
また、PoWは環境負荷が高いという批判も受けていました。大量の電力消費は、地球温暖化などの環境問題に寄与する可能性があります。これらの課題を解決するために、イーサリアムの開発コミュニティは、長年にわたりアップグレードの計画を進めてきました。
2. The Merge(PoSへの移行)
イーサリアムの歴史において最も重要なアップグレードの一つが、The Merge(マージ)と呼ばれるPoS(Proof of Stake)への移行です。The Mergeは、イーサリアムのコンセンサスアルゴリズムをPoWからPoSに変更するもので、2022年9月に実行されました。
PoSでは、トランザクションの検証を「バリデーター」と呼ばれる参加者が行います。バリデーターは、イーサリアムを保有している量に応じて選出され、トランザクションを検証することで報酬を得ることができます。PoSは、PoWと比較して、電力消費量が大幅に少なく、スケーラビリティも向上すると期待されています。
The Mergeの実行により、イーサリアムのエネルギー消費量は99.95%以上削減されたと報告されています。これは、環境負荷の低減に大きく貢献するものです。また、PoSへの移行は、イーサリアムのセキュリティも向上させると考えられています。PoSでは、悪意のある攻撃者がネットワークを支配するために、大量のイーサリアムを保有する必要があるため、攻撃コストが高くなります。
3. Shanghai アップグレード
The Mergeに続く重要なアップグレードとして、Shanghai(上海)アップグレードが挙げられます。Shanghai アップグレードは、2023年4月に実行され、PoSで獲得したイーサリアムの引き出しを可能にしました。The Merge以降、バリデーターはイーサリアムをステーキングして報酬を得ていましたが、それらのイーサリアムを引き出すことができませんでした。Shanghai アップグレードにより、バリデーターはステーキングしたイーサリアムを引き出すことができるようになり、イーサリアムのエコシステムに流動性をもたらしました。
Shanghai アップグレードには、EIP-4895(BEACON CHAIN PUSH withdrawals AS OPERATION)やEIP-3860(Limit and meter resource usage)など、複数のEIP(Ethereum Improvement Proposals)が含まれていました。これらのEIPは、イーサリアムのパフォーマンスとセキュリティを向上させることを目的としています。
4. Cancun アップグレードとProto-Danksharding
現在、イーサリアムの開発コミュニティは、Cancun(カンクン)アップグレードの準備を進めています。Cancun アップグレードは、2024年初頭に実行される予定であり、EIP-4844(Proto-Danksharding)と呼ばれる重要な機能が含まれています。
Proto-Dankshardingは、Dankshardingと呼ばれるスケーリングソリューションのプロトタイプです。Dankshardingは、イーサリアムのトランザクション処理能力を大幅に向上させることを目的としています。具体的には、データ可用性サンプリングと呼ばれる技術を使用することで、トランザクションの検証に必要な計算量を削減し、ガス代を低減することができます。
EIP-4844は、Blobと呼ばれる新しいデータ構造を導入します。Blobは、トランザクションデータの一部を格納するために使用され、通常のトランザクションデータよりも安価に保存することができます。これにより、Layer 2ソリューション(イーサリアム上に構築されたスケーリングソリューション)のガス代を大幅に削減することができます。
5. その他のアップグレードと今後の展望
イーサリアムの開発コミュニティは、Cancun アップグレード以降も、継続的にアップグレードを計画しています。例えば、Dankshardingの完全な実装や、アカウント抽象化(Account Abstraction)と呼ばれる新しいアカウントモデルの導入などが検討されています。
アカウント抽象化は、スマートコントラクトを使用してアカウントの機能をカスタマイズすることを可能にするものです。これにより、ユーザーはより柔軟なアカウント管理が可能になり、セキュリティも向上すると期待されています。また、アカウント抽象化は、Web3アプリケーションのユーザーエクスペリエンスを向上させる可能性を秘めています。
イーサリアムのアップグレードは、ネットワークの進化を促進し、より多くのユーザーと開発者を引き付けることを目的としています。これらのアップグレードは、イーサリアムを分散型アプリケーションの基盤としてさらに強固なものにし、Web3の普及に貢献すると考えられます。
6. アップグレードがもたらす影響
イーサリアムのアップグレードは、様々な影響をもたらします。以下に、主な影響をまとめます。
- スケーラビリティの向上: Proto-Dankshardingなどのアップグレードにより、トランザクション処理能力が向上し、ガス代が低減されます。
- セキュリティの強化: PoSへの移行や、その他のセキュリティ関連のアップグレードにより、ネットワークのセキュリティが向上します。
- 環境負荷の低減: PoSへの移行により、電力消費量が大幅に削減され、環境負荷が低減されます。
- 開発者エクスペリエンスの向上: アカウント抽象化などのアップグレードにより、開発者はより柔軟なアプリケーションを開発できるようになります。
- ユーザーエクスペリエンスの向上: ガス代の低減や、アカウント抽象化による柔軟なアカウント管理により、ユーザーエクスペリエンスが向上します。
7. まとめ
イーサリアムは、継続的なアップグレードを通じて、その技術的な課題を克服し、より優れた分散型プラットフォームへと進化しています。The MergeによるPoSへの移行、Shanghai アップグレードによるステーキングイーサリアムの引き出し、そして今後のCancun アップグレードによるスケーラビリティの向上など、これらのアップグレードは、イーサリアムのエコシステム全体に大きな影響を与えるでしょう。イーサリアムの進化は、Web3の未来を形作る上で重要な役割を果たすと期待されます。開発者、投資家、そしてユーザーは、これらのアップグレードの動向を注視し、その影響を理解しておくことが重要です。イーサリアムの進化は、単なる技術的な進歩にとどまらず、分散型金融(DeFi)や非代替性トークン(NFT)などの新しいアプリケーションの可能性を広げ、社会全体に革新をもたらす可能性があります。